Sandyland Reef Inn

Sandyland Reef Inn is a charming lodging institution located at 4160 Via Real in Carpinteria, California, United States. Just a short drive from Carpinteria State Beach, this non-smoking motel offers comfortable rooms with cable TV featuring HBO, as well as free Wi-Fi and complimentary toiletries in each room. Guests can enjoy the outdoor pool and hot tub during their stay. The convenient location of Sandyland Reef Inn, visible from Freeway 101, makes it a great choice for travelers looking to explore the Santa Barbara and Carpinteria area. With a variety of room styles available, including king, queen, and double beds, guests can relax and unwind in this Santa Barbara charm. Whether you're looking to relax on the beach, visit nearby attractions like the Solvang Antique Center or Santa Barbara Botanic Gardens, or partake in water activities or wine tasting tours, Sandyland Reef Inn is the perfect choice. Additional amenities include free parking, room service, facilities for disabled guests, and a spa. For a comfortable and affordable stay in Carpinteria, look no further than Sandyland Reef Inn.
